§ Biography

S/Sgt. Elmer G. Krummert served as waist gunner aboard B-24J 42-50606 on the 12 October 1944 mission to Osnabruck.

Krummert was killed when the aircraft was shot down. A supplementary German report (Casualty No. KU 3161, dated 5 January 1945) confirms he was dead and interred at the Prisoner of War Cemetery, Achmer, Grave 116.
